MARK MICHAEL STARODUB
February 28, 1957 - February 27, 2021

It is with the heaviest of hearts that we announce the sudden passing of Mark on February 27, 2021, the day before his 64th birthday.
He was predeceased by his father Peter, father and mother-in-law, Charles and Margaret Fox, niece Stacey Fox, sister-in-law Linda Fox, and brother-in-law Louie Smelsky. Greeting him from across the rainbow bridge will be his beloved pets, Taffy, Kelsey, Muffy and Murphy.
Left to mourn his tragic loss is his loving wife Charlene who has 44 years of cherished memories. Also mourning his loss are his mother Pauline, his sisters, Maryanne Peters and Joanne Starodub, and brothers, Peter (Jacquie, Liz, Caitlin) and Greg (Lorraine, Georgia), in-laws, Harold Fox (Pat), Ron Fox, Lynne Hallam (Doug), Sandra Cronin (Gary), nephews, Chris Hallam (Angela, Kayla, Meghan), Jay Hallam (Michelle) and Scott Fox (Kim, Jonas). Also missing Mark is his beloved dog Mindy of 13 years. A huge paw print has been left on his soul.
Mark worked at Gerdau in the spec lab and retired in 2017. He also spent some time teaching, which included terms in Lockport, Teulon and Winnipeg. Upon retirement he had more time to participate in his favourite past time - golf. He was an avid golfer, golfing almost daily. Mark enjoyed travelling, was a whiz at math, had a very quick wit, and could be very tech savvy. Since retirement, he and Charlene were fortunate to spend the last few winters in Florida with their friends, Jennifer and Bill. His Florida golf courses were his "happy places" where he made many American, Finnish and Canadian snowbird friends.
As per Mark's wishes, cremation has taken place and there will be no formal service.
Anyone so wishing may make a donation in Mark's memory to CancerCare or an animal shelter of your choice.
